| 裏面の説明 | Central field depicts a dramatic scene after the original illustrations of Ingrid Vang Nyman, showing Pippi Longstocking grappling with a large open-mouthed shark emerging from stylised ocean waves. Pippi, shown with her characteristic pigtails, is rendered partially submerged at lower right, gripping the shark with both hands in a scene of spirited confrontation. The arc legend PIPPI IN THE SOUTH SEAS appears along the upper border. The copyright credit © INGRID VANG- NYMAN is inscribed in the lower left field. |

Niue has operated a bullion and collector coin program since the 1990s, licensing pop-culture and literary properties as a revenue mechanism — the island's GDP from coin royalties has at times exceeded that of several other economic activities combined. The Pippi Longstocking licensing arrangement with the Astrid Lindgren estate is among the more formally structured of these deals, requiring design approval from Lindgren's heirs.
The specific title references Lindgren's 1948 novel Pippi Långstrump i Söderhavet, in which Pippi travels to a fictional South Sea island where her father reigns as king.
